Dorothy Alice Hughes

Mrs. Dorothy Alice Hughes, 95, a resident of Kentwood, died at the Belle Masion Nursing Home in Hammond, LA on Tuesday, April 20, 2021.

Graveside services will be held at 1:00 PM on Monday, April 26, 2021 at the Woodland Cemetery in Kentwood, Louisiana.  The Reverend Justin Craft will officiate. Burial will be in the Woodland Cemetery with Hartman-Jones Funeral Home in charge of the arrangements.

Mrs. Hughes was born July 5, 1925 in Bogalusa, Louisiana. She was the daughter of the late Marshall and Edna Furr Rester. 

She was a homemaker and a member of the Line Creek Baptist Church where she taught Sunday School.  She was also a member of the Ladies Art Guild. 

She was preceded in death by her parents; her husband of 70 years, Redo “Jack” Henry Hughes and one brother and his wife, Clyde and Mary Rester.

Mrs. Hughes is survived by three sons, Jack D Hughes and wife, Mary C. of Kentwood, Louisiana; Paul M. Hughes and wife, Mary W. of Grand Junction, Colorado and Mark C. Hughes and wife, Dera H. of Kentwood, Louisiana;  six grandchildren,  J.D. Hughes and wife, Bridgette, Daniel Hughes and wife, Laura, Brandy Hughes, Mandy Hughes and husband, Marc Boren, Jeremy Hughes and wife, Jamie, and Elizabeth Cash and husband, Shane; nine great-grandchildren, Matthew, Madalynne, Parker, Annabel, Avery, Hannah-Kay, Hayden, Christopher and Cordelia.

Pallbearers will be Matthew Hughes, Parker Hughes, J.D. Hughes, Jeremy Hughes and Shane Cash.
